Overview

Cable conduits for equipment rooms are specialized tubes designed to protect and organize cables in high-tech environments such as data centers and server rooms. They ensure cables remain untangled, shielded from physical damage, and compliant with safety standards. These conduits come in various materials, including PVC, galvanized steel, and flexible plastics, each suited for different applications. Proper cable management is critical in equipment rooms to prevent overheating, reduce electromagnetic interference, and facilitate maintenance. Conduits are often color-coded or labeled for easy identification of cable types, enhancing operational efficiency and reducing downtime during repairs or upgrades.

Structure and Working Principle

Cable conduits typically feature a hollow cylindrical structure, allowing multiple cables to pass through. Rigid conduits, such as those made from galvanized steel, provide robust protection against physical impacts, while flexible conduits offer ease of installation in complex layouts. Some models include fire-resistant coatings or shielding to meet stringent safety regulations. The working principle revolves around enclosing cables within a protective barrier, shielding them from environmental hazards like moisture, dust, and mechanical stress. Conduits may also incorporate features like snap-on lids or split designs for quick access during maintenance, ensuring minimal disruption to operations.

Key Features

Fire resistance is a critical feature, especially for conduits used in high-risk areas. Many products are rated for flame retardancy and low smoke emission, complying with international safety standards. Durability is another key factor, as conduits must withstand long-term use without degrading. Flexibility and ease of installation are highly valued, particularly in retrofit projects where space constraints exist. Some conduits include pre-installed pull tapes or smooth inner surfaces to simplify cable insertion. Additionally, UV-resistant and corrosion-proof variants are available for outdoor or harsh environments.

Application Areas

Cable conduits are indispensable in data centers, where they manage extensive networks of power and data cables. They are also used in telecom facilities, industrial control rooms, and office buildings with high-density IT infrastructure. Proper conduit selection ensures compliance with local building codes and reduces the risk of cable-related failures. In addition to equipment rooms, these conduits are employed in renewable energy installations, such as solar farms, to protect wiring from environmental damage. Their versatility makes them suitable for both indoor and outdoor applications, provided the material matches the environmental conditions.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ular inspections are recommended to check for wear, damage, or loose fittings. Conduits should be kept clean and free of debris to prevent blockages that could hinder cable movement. Avoid overfilling conduits, as this can cause overheating and difficulty during maintenance. When installing conduits, ensure they are properly grounded if metallic, to prevent electrical hazards. Follow manufacturer guidelines for bending radii to avoid damaging cables. Always adhere to fire safety regulations, especially in critical infrastructure where conduit failure could have severe consequences.
